Well, I'm a little disappointed in the Horcrux thing for this very
reason. I don't see how we could really have figured it out from
what we had in the previous books. Indeed I don't know of anyone
who did.
In fact, my whole line of reasoning was that therefore Voldemort's
remarks about the steps he had taken must be a red herring
(supported by the fact that in GOF he doesn't know *which* steps had
worked, and that Dumbledore stresses that Voldemort doesn't
understand the really important things in magic).
